The series was born from a remarkably personal and creative process. Han Seung-won has stated that the world and characters of Princess came to her in a vivid dream over three days. This dreamlike origin is palpable in the story's rich, detailed world-building and its blend of sweeping romance and stark political reality. Her works are known for their deep emotional resonance, characters driven by desire who struggle against a tragic fate, and a willingness to confront heartbreak and loss without always delivering a fairy-tale happy ending.
